How Our Broken Pipe Water Removal Process Works
When you suspect a pipe has burst, it’s essential to act fast. Our team will assess the damage and create a customized plan to get your home back to normal. Here’s a step-by-step overview of what you can expect: Our team will be with you every step of the way.
Step 1: Emergency Response
Within 60 minutes of your call, our team will arrive on-site to assess the damage and start the water removal process. We’ll get the water out quickly and efficiently, reducing further damage.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use specialized equipment to extract as much water as possible from your property, including carpets, upholstery, and other porous materials. Our team will work quickly to reduce further damage and prevent mold grow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and fans to dry out your property, including walls, ceilings, and floors. Our team will work tirelessly to ensure your home is dry and safe.
Step 4: Sanitation and Disinfection
We’ll thoroughly sanitize and disinfect all affected areas to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ria. Our team will ensure your home is safe and healthy for you and your family.
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ction
We’ll work with you to restore and reconstruct any damaged areas, including walls, floors, and ceilings. Our team will ensure your home looks and feels like new.

Broken Pipe Water Removal Cost in Milford Mill, MD
The cost of Broken Pipe Water Removal can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Milford Mill, MD. Here are some estimated price ranges for common Broken Pipe Water Removal services: Keep in mind that these are estimates, and actual costs may vary.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Emergency Response and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used, and duration of drying process. |
| Sanitation and Disinfection |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ials used, and level of contamination. |
| Restoration and Reconstruction |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ials used, and level of damage. |
